Transform Your Smile with Veneers
If you have gaps, chips, stains, or misshapen teeth, you no longer have to hide. Veneers can easily correct your teeth’s imperfections so you can have a more confident smile. Veneers are natural looking and perfect for patients looking to make minor adjustments to their smile.
Custom-made shells made from tooth-colored materials (such as porcelain) Veneers are made to cover the front side of your teeth. Your doctor will first start by creating a mold of your teeth. This mold will be sent to a dental technician who creates your veneers. Before placing the veneer, your dentist will most likely have to conservatively prepare your tooth to achieve the optimal result.
When your veneers are placed, you will be pleased to see that they blend in with your natural teeth. while veneers are stain-resistant, your dentist may recommend that you avoid tobacco, and dark liquids (coffee, tea, and red wine) in order to maintain the beauty of your new smile.

Am I eligible to be considered as a candidate for veneers?
Porcelain veneers are an excellent solution for small cracks or chips in your teeth, as well as for small teeth that do not match the rest of your smile. They can improve your dental aesthetics and enhance your facial features. Moreover, if you have intrinsic stains that are resistant to whitening treatments, veneers may be a suitable option for you.
It is important to understand that veneers are primarily a cosmetic treatment and do not address major orthodontic issues, decay, or tooth loss. Prior to getting veneers, it is necessary for your teeth to be strong enough to support them. Our office will conduct an oral health evaluation to determine if you are a suitable candidate for the procedure. If you have any existing oral health issues, we will need to address them before beginning the veneer treatment.
Advantages Of Veneers
DURABLE
Porcelain veneers are made from a durable and stain-resistant porcelain material, which means they are built to last. Unlike materials that are porous and prone to absorbing stains, porcelain veneers maintain their vibrant appearance over time. To enhance the brightness of your smile even further, you may also want to consider teeth whitening treatments.
COLOR MATCHING
When it comes to color matching, many patients choose to undergo teeth whitening before getting veneers. This is done to ensure that the veneers seamlessly blend in with the surrounding teeth, which have been enhanced to a stunning new shade.
LONG TERM
When properly maintained, veneers can last for an average of 10 years, showcasing their long-term durability.
